Output 23c89ab02fbf9b6405360b0caecc53c70e24075b4179f48bb5b7674844b163c1:26

value
84003
script pubkey
OP_0 OP_PUSHBYTES_20 a8f59e9555d424615fa164c827bb5c658922bf74
address
bc1q4r6ea9246sjxzhapvnyz0w6uvkyj90m5e69q9q
transaction
23c89ab02fbf9b6405360b0caecc53c70e24075b4179f48bb5b7674844b163c1
spent
true